Transaction c766d6804ebcd2ea5ba9311c5965230ed06e8ae190f1eb5016e1ea739f1afbca

1 Input
2 Outputs
  • c766d6804ebcd2ea5ba9311c5965230ed06e8ae190f1eb5016e1ea739f1afbca:0
  • value  1068063
    address  3CXR4dCJY3LQAZ6c3oaF4kMvRLhgwFfqYZ
  • c766d6804ebcd2ea5ba9311c5965230ed06e8ae190f1eb5016e1ea739f1afbca:1
  • value  5293577
    address  1E65g8hC85QFB7kiaEEzcBbeqnhnggbHbZ